My current code reproduces this fairly readily, I am seeing
it many dozens/hundreds of times a day.
I tweaked guile to check that the stack bounds are in order,
and to print an error message when they are, and then to
just troop on -- and so I see dozens/hundreds of prints.
When the stack bounds are reversed, the difference
is *always* 58 bytes; and in fact, the two bad stack
bounds are always the same.
It appears to happen *only* when I have multiple threads
all trying to define functions at the same time, it never
happens when one thread goes off to do some heavy
computing.
